The 170th day of the war opens in Ukraine, with Russian forces last night bombing two districts of the Dnepropetrovsk region - Nikopol and Krivoy Rog , not far from Zaporizhzhia , causing at least three injuries , according to the president of the regional military administration, Valentin Reznichenko, according to UNIAN reports.

According to Reznichenko, the Nikopol district was hit 10 times with Grad rocket launchers and artillery fire. In addition, up to 40 rockets were fired in the direction of Marganets and three people were injured , including a 12-year-old boy. Shooting also in Zelenodolsk, in the Krivoy Rog district, as confirmation arrives that over six tons of ammonia have leaked from a tank of the cooling system of a brewery in the Donetsk region of Ukraine damaged yesterday by a bombing by Ukrainian forces.

In the meantime, two other cargo ships loaded with cereals will leave Ukraine today for Iran and Turkey: the ship bound for Iran is the Star Laura, with 60,150 tons of corn, while the one bound for Turkey - the Sormovskiy - will carry 3,050 tons of grain.

In Italy, in Ravenna, the Rojen, the first ship with cereals from Ukraine, has landed : the cargo is made up of 15 thousand tons of corn seeds. She left Chornomorsk, near Odessa, on 5 August. "A very important day", commented the mayor of Ravenna Michele De Pascale, because it represents "a small step towards a return to normality" in commercial exchanges, although at the moment the possibility is limited to agri-food traffics. On the issue of nuclear power , Russia is once again attacking: "Ukraine's criminal acts against the Zaporizhzhia nuclear power plant are pushing the world to the brink of a nuclear disaster comparable to Chernobyl," said the Russian ambassador to the UN, Vasily Nebenzia. , during the meeting of the Security Council. "We have repeatedly warned our Western colleagues that if they fail to bring the Kiev government to reason, it will resort to more heinous and senseless acts that will reverberate far beyond Ukraine's borders. Unfortunately, this is exactly what is happening now." , he added. Moscow then declared itself in favor of the visit of the Aiea experts .

Kiev, Moscow launched five missiles against Zaporizhzhia

Russian forces attacked the city of Zaporizhzhia, hitting a gas station and infrastructure in the Shevchenkivskyi district. This was reported on Telegram by Anatoliy Kurtiev, interim mayor of Zaporizhzhia, quoted by the news agency Ukrinform. There are also reports of explosions on the outskirts of the city being verified. Earlier, Oleksandr Starukh, head of the Zaporizhzhia regional military administration, wrote on Telegram that five missiles had been fired at Zaporizhzhia. A fire would have broken out and, according to preliminary information, a woman would have been injured, but these news are to be verified.

Medvedev attacks Zelensky, "in his future court or show"

Former Russian president and current number two of the Russian Security Council, Dmitry Medvedev, attacked Volodymyr Zelensky saying that, according to him, in the future of the Ukrainian president there are "either a court or again secondary roles in comedy shows". This was reported by the Russian state news agency Tass citing an interview with Medvedev by Nadan Fridrikhson published on the Telegram channel of Vladimir Putin's ally. Russian troops invaded Ukraine in February causing a bloody war in the heart of Europe. In recent months, Medvedev has published on social media statements that are often very harsh and full of rhetoric and propaganda against the West and against Ukraine and therefore much criticized.

1.30 pm - 98% of Ukrainian citizens believe in Kiev's victory

98% of Ukrainians believe in Ukraine's victory over Russia and 91% approve of the work of President Volodymyr Zelensky: this is what emerges from a survey carried out on June 27-28 by the Sociological Evaluation Group on behalf of the Center for in-depth research on the polls of the Republican International Institute. Ukrainska Pravda reports it.

Bomb dropped 10 meters from the Zaporizhzhia depot

An artillery shell fired by Ukrainian forces struck just ten meters from a depleted nuclear fuel at the Russian-controlled Zaporizhzhia power plant in southern Ukraine. This was stated by Vladimir Rogov, a member of the civil-military authority of the part of the region occupied by the forces of Moscow. According to Rogov, who was speaking on Rossiya-24 television, filmed by Tass, the incident took place yesterday.

Moscow, the Zaporizhzhia power plant cannot be returned to Kiev

The Zaporizhzhia nuclear power plant cannot be returned to Ukraine because Kiev is unable to guarantee its safety: the vice president of the Russian Senate, Konstantin Kosachyov, told the Interfax agency today. "The only way to ensure the safety of the nuclear power plant is 100% control of its activity. Given the special military operation, the Ukrainian authorities are unable to provide this type of control by definition," Kosachyov said.

Moscow: "If there is a nuclear catastrophe, Biden and Zelensky will be responsible"

The responsibility for the potential tragic consequences of the attacks on the Ukrainian nuclear power plant in Zaporizhzhia will lie with the president of the United States, Joe Biden, and with the Ukrainian president Volodymyr Zelensky: the speaker of the Duma, Vyacheslav Volodin, says on Telegram, according to reports from Tass. "The actions of Washington and the Kiev regime risk a nuclear catastrophe", writes the speaker of the lower house of the Russian parliament.
